How Do I Know When My LiFePO4 Battery Is Fully Charged?ed?
To determine when your LiFePO4 (Lithium Iron Phosphate) battery is fully charged, monitor the voltage. A fully charged LiFePO4 battery typically reaches 3.6 to 3.65 volts per cell. Additionally, most modern chargers have built-in indicators that signal when charging is complete, ensuring optimal performance and safety. Understanding LiFePO4

Easy Steps to Check the State of Charge in Your LiFePO4 Battery!
If you own a LiFePO4 battery, knowing its State of Charge (SOC) is essential. SOC tells you how much energy is left in your battery, much like a gas gauge in your car. Monitoring SOC helps you avoid unexpected power loss and keeps your battery healthy. This blog will walk you through easy steps to check the SOC.
